Arranging food beautifully improves your eating habits


After cooking, take some time to put the food beautifully on platters or plates, even when it is simply for you personally or you plus one body else. I sometimes decorate the platters: a flower grabbed externally sits alongside slices of seared fish, or curls of orange carrot alongside slices of tofu. I juxtapose colors and textures and arrange foods in neat ways.

It pleases the artist in me to pay focus on the way the food looks altogether. As my round-the-island family dinners can lead you to separate plates and bowls, it's a good chance to make meals look colorful and appealing or use fun serving utensils.

Whenever you put consideration into each one of these details while you serve meals, you bring the main focus towards the moment and make a daily act more significant.

Have you got a dining area table or perhaps a dining table? It's there because you're designed to spend time at it to consume, whether alone, with friends, or with your family. If you do not have a table focused on eating, then might you make an area in your home that is dedicated to meals? I spend five minutes to put the table while your meals are cooking.

I released a location setting for each person, including mats and napkins, and that i fill a water glass for each person. I put something in the core table: a potted plant or some flowers basically ask them to. The dogs get locked outside, and also the TV in the family room is turned off and then we can't listen to it. Telephone calls don't get answered.

Lunchtime, when I'm home alone, is usually a time that i can sit and reflect. Dinnertime is really a opportunity to interact with my hubby and youngsters and often with friends. Life rushes by so quickly that as we don't sit around a table, our days could pass with minimal communication.

A high level parent, In my opinion that you lose tabs on your kids if you don't once in a while take a seat while dining and also have those family talks. It might be unrealistic to get it done every night, but perhaps one day per week you can alert the children in advance: "Tonight, guys, we're eating together."

If you are at the office and your option is limited, make a little gesture of treating food with respect. Look for a spot to eat that is well from your workstation, and head outdoors when the weather conditions are nice. Leave reading material and mobile phones behind. State an affirmation quietly and deliberately while you take a seat for your meal: "This is time for nourishment and calm."

Everyone occasionally eats a store-bought meal at the office or in your own home. Even when it is simply a sandwich or sushi in a plastic tray, take two minutes to transfer your meal to proper dishware, and ditch the disposable cutlery and paper napkin that included it. Use real cutlery, and take a seat in a table (note: not your desk) to consume. You will not lose whenever, but your connection with your food will change.
